This is pricing for University provided Cellular service (mobile) for University use. More plans and vendors will be added as they become available.

Note: All vendors require a new line of service when purchased with a discounted device to remain active for a minimum of 12 months, with the option to suspend the line without billing for two 90 day periods during that activation period. Other plans are available by request.

Tethering = using a mobile signal as a WI-FI, then hooking up a laptop etc to the internet. Sometime referred to as a mobile hotspot. Limited to 10GB.

DTL = Data Throughput Limitation aka throttling. When a user exceeds 22GB of data usage in a given bill cycle, the data speeds will be reduced to 200 kbps (up/down) until the new bill cycle starts
